What is the difference between Junior Java Developer vs Java Developer?

AspectJunior Java DeveloperJava Developer
Required Experience0-2 years2+ years
CertificationsOptional, entry-level certificationsOptional, advanced certifications
Work EnvironmentSupportive, learning-focused teamsProject-driven, independent roles
ResponsibilitiesAssist in coding, bug fixing, learning frameworksDesign, develop, maintain Java applications

The main difference between a Junior Java Developer and a Java Developer lies in experience, responsibilities, and independence. Junior Java Developers are typically entry-level, focusing on learning and supporting tasks, while Java Developers have more experience and handle complex development projects independently.

Is Java still useful in 2026?

Java remains a widely used programming language for developing enterprise applications, Android apps, and backend systems in 2026. Junior Java Developers can benefit from its stability, extensive libraries, and strong community support, making it a valuable skill in the software industry. Knowledge of frameworks like Spring and tools such as Maven or Gradle enhances job prospects.

What are Junior Java Developers?

Junior Java Developers are entry-level software engineers who specialize in building and maintaining applications using the Java programming language. They typically work under the supervision of more experienced developers and are responsible for writing code, debugging, and participating in code reviews. Their tasks may also include testing software, learning new frameworks, and assisting with the design and implementation of features. Junior Java Developers usually have foundational knowledge of Java and related technologies, and they are eager to develop their skills through hands-on experience.

What are some common challenges a Junior Java Developer might face during their first year, and how can they overcome them?

Junior Java Developers often encounter challenges such as understanding large codebases, adapting to agile development processes, and managing task priorities. To overcome these hurdles, it’s helpful to proactively seek mentorship from senior developers, regularly review documentation, and participate in code reviews. Effective communication with team members also accelerates learning and helps clarify requirements or technical uncertainties. Embracing continuous learning through online resources and hands-on projects will further strengthen your skills and confidence.

What are the key skills and qualifications needed to thrive as a Junior Java Developer, and why are they important?

A Junior Java Developer should have a solid understanding of Java programming, object-oriented principles, and basic software development concepts, often supported by a relevant degree or coding bootcamp. Familiarity with tools such as IntelliJ IDEA or Eclipse, version control systems like Git, and frameworks like Spring Boot is typically expected. Strong problem-solving abilities, attention to detail, and effective teamwork are important soft skills in this role. These competencies enable efficient code development, smooth collaboration, and the ability to quickly adapt to new technologies and project requirements.

Will AI replace Java devs?

AI is unlikely to fully replace Java developers, as they require problem-solving, design, and understanding of complex systems that AI cannot fully replicate. Instead, AI tools can assist Java developers by automating repetitive tasks and improving productivity, making their roles more efficient. Continuous learning and adapting to new technologies remain important for Java developers to stay relevant in the evolving tech landscape.
